What affects the price

The final cost of your fireplace depends on several moving parts. Choosing between a simple insert and a full custom masonry build changes the labor intensity significantly. You also need to consider the complexity of the venting system and whether your home requires structural modifications to accommodate the unit safely. High-end materials like natural stone or custom glass doors will naturally push the budget higher, while standard finishes keep things more affordable. About this service

To get the most heat and the least amount of creosote buildup, you should only burn seasoned hardwoods. Oak, maple, and ash are excellent choices because they are dense and burn slowly. Avoid burning green or wet wood, as it produces more smoke and less heat. The wood should be split and dried for at least six months before use. Using the right fuel keeps your chimney cleaner and makes your fireplace much easier to manage.
